Follow these steps and check if this helps.
- Insert a blank recordable DVD into the DVD drive. When you insert a blank DVD into the drive, Windows automatically prompts you with some options.
- Select "Burn files to disc”. Another dialogue box appears with the two types of format options.
- Type a name for the DVD disk in the section labelled "Burn a disc”. Use a friendly name for the DVD. This is the label for the drive that will show when you insert it into the computer.
- Click the "Show formatting option”. This opens the list of format options. Choose the type of format you want for the DVD. If you use only Windows, the most convenient type to choose is the live file system. Click the "Next" button. Windows formats the DVD at this point.
- Test the disc by dragging and dropping a file to the DVD. You are now able to save files to the disk.
